6417 /()   imageAlaska, 1925 Arctic Air Mercy Flight labels, 30 different color combinations, comprising complete sets of 10 each with gold and silver overprinted margins, plus five with unoverprinted margins and five on cream paper; the first two sets are o.g. and mostly never hinged, the others without gum, Very Fine.
Suggested Bid $150


These stamps were for a proposed flight to carry serum to counter a diptheria outbreak in Nome. Because of Nome's proximity to the Arctic Circle, the mid-winter flight was considered too dangerous. Ultimately, the serum was despatched by a dog sled relay carried out in five and a half days by 20 "mushers" and about 150 dogs, in temperatures lower than 50° below zero. For an interesting article detailing the full story see Wikipedia: https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/1925_serum_run_to_Nome

The central design of the stamps was modeled after the 1925 Norwegian stamps that were issued to fund Roald Amundsen's North Pole Flight.
